Overview
Meridian is a text-based adult RPG for players who want a slower, mystery-tinged household drama with a quiet, unsettling tone.
Story
You've been sleeping badly for four months, waking at exactly ten past four with the sense of having been somewhere else, somewhere wet. Meridian builds its plot around that recurring waking moment, treating it as the thread that pulls the rest of the household's secrets loose.
Gameplay
Play centers on a male protagonist navigating a shared house full of women, moving through text-driven scenes and choices that shift depending on who you talk to and when. Sandbox-style days let you decide how to spend your time, building toward individual routes with each housemate as trust and familiarity change what's available to you.

Changelog
v0.2
- New sixth housemate MAREN, the one who was here before. She walks up out of the current two days after the first Seal breaks, and the empty bedroom you've been sleeping in all along was hers. Two scenes and her own Reciprocal route
- Maren has eight videos, so six position buttons against everyone else's four, including one where nobody touches her
- Full voice acting: 283 lines, up from 218. And voice follows your reading now instead of the other way round, each line playing when you reach it with no scroll locking. Press V anywhere to switch modes
- New THE WORLD screen in the menu: 26 entries on the Meridian, the Ford, custodians, the Weir, the Radiance and shifts, plus the clock table. Nothing the story hasn't told you yet shows up
- The gallery is an actual gallery: image cards, all 11 scenes including the locked ones with exactly what you're missing, and replaying one plays the whole scene with its choices and its video. Free in all three editions
- Fixed the run-killer: Sediment was locked behind itself. Dives were the only source and only opened after a study that cost 10, launched from an Observatory that cost 30, out of the 40 you start with. One extra night's upkeep and the run was unwinnable. Dives are open from the start now, and it repairs saves that were already stuck
- Fixed: the Voice's scene could not be reached. "Step towards the centre" only appeared if you had already played the scene it leads to, so the Dead Ford always read "There's nothing here". The whole of act I hangs off that task
- Fixed: Sabine's pantry and Cielo's notebooks vanished the moment you chose, because the time they charged pushed the clock past the end of the day. A scene never puts you to bed now
- Food stops ambushing you: 18 provisions to start instead of 6, the HUD says how many nights of food are left, and a new STARTING THE MERIDIAN checklist walks you through the whole loop and then disappears for good
- 3 new achievements (68 in total), 2 new scenes (11 in total), and everything new is written in both languages
